The Art of Perfectly Crispy Bacon
Achieving that coveted perfect crunch in your bacon is essential for these cheese bites. There are a couple of tried-and-true methods to ensure your bacon is wonderfully crispy and flavorful. You can either pan-fry whole slices of bacon, allow them to cool completely, and then crumble them, or you can opt for cutting the bacon into small pieces before frying.
For pre-cut bacon bits, a pro tip is to slice the bacon with kitchen scissors while it’s still cold. Cold bacon is firmer and much easier to cut into uniform pieces, which helps them cook evenly. Once cut, pan-fry the pieces over medium heat until they are golden brown and perfectly crispy. This method often results in a more consistent crispiness compared to crumbling larger, already cooked slices.
After cooking, it’s crucial to let your bacon bits rest on a layer of paper towels. This step allows any excess grease to drain off, which is key to maintaining maximum crunchiness. Removing the grease prevents the bacon from becoming soggy when mixed with other ingredients and ensures it retains its delightful texture, making it absolutely perfect for these cheesy, sweet, and savory bites!
Experiment with different thicknesses of bacon – thicker cuts will yield heartier, chewier bits, while thinner cuts will be extra crisp and delicate. Regardless of your preference, remember that the goal is a beautiful golden-brown color and a satisfying snap when you bite into it.





Essential Ingredients for These Easy Appetizers
We’ve meticulously crafted these cheesy bacon and cheese bites to be incredibly simple, utilizing just a handful of readily available ingredients. You won’t need to hunt for exotic items; everything required can be easily found at your local grocery store, making this a hassle-free recipe even for last-minute party preparations.
- 1.9 ounce package phyllo cups: These pre-made, flaky pastry shells are a true game-changer. They provide an instant, elegant base for our bites, saving you valuable time and effort compared to working with raw phyllo dough. Look for them in the freezer section of your grocery store, often near puff pastry or other specialty doughs.
- 8 ounces brie or camembert cheese: The creamy, mild richness of Brie is an absolute dream in this recipe, melting beautifully to create a luxurious texture. Camembert, with its slightly more robust, earthy flavor, also works wonderfully if you prefer a bolder cheese profile. Both cheeses offer a delightful contrast to the sweet preserves and savory bacon.
- Raspberry preserves: The vibrant, tart sweetness of raspberry preserves cuts through the richness of the cheese and the saltiness of the bacon, creating a perfectly balanced flavor profile. We specifically recommend preserves over jam or jelly for their slightly chunkier fruit texture and often less saccharine taste.
- 4 slices cooked bacon, finely chopped: The star of the savory show! Crispy, salty bacon bits provide that essential crunch and a deep, smoky flavor that elevates these bites from simple to sensational. Ensure it’s cooked to perfection and finely chopped for even distribution.
Each ingredient plays a crucial role in creating the irresistible balance of flavors and textures in these bites. The crispness of the phyllo, the creaminess of the cheese, the sweetness and tartness of the raspberry, and the smoky crunch of the bacon all come together to create a truly unforgettable appetizer.

Explore Other Delightful Preserves
While we adore the classic combination of raspberry preserves in these easy appetizers, the beauty of this recipe lies in its versatility. You can effortlessly customize the flavor profile by experimenting with a variety of tart and sweet preserves. We consistently recommend using preserves over thinner jams or jellies. Preserves offer a more robust, fruit-forward experience with a delightful chunky texture that adds depth and character to each bite, complementing the rich cheese and savory bacon much better than overly sweet, smooth jellies.
Here are some of our favorite alternative preserves that pair exceptionally well with the rich flavors of brie or camembert and the salty notes of bacon:
- Tart Cherry Preserves: These provide a wonderfully bright and tangy counterpoint, with a slight tartness that beautifully balances the richness of the cheese and the savory bacon.
- Lingonberry Jam: Hailing from Nordic cuisine, lingonberry jam offers a distinct tartness with a subtle sweetness, similar to cranberries but with its unique forest berry essence. It creates a sophisticated and intriguing flavor combination.
- Blueberry Preserves: For a slightly mellower, yet equally delightful option, blueberry preserves bring a gentle sweetness and mild tartness. The blueberries burst with flavor when warmed, adding a comforting touch.
- Fig Preserves: For a more gourmet and earthy twist, fig preserves are an excellent choice. Their deep, honeyed sweetness and unique texture create a sophisticated flavor profile that pairs exceptionally well with rich cheeses and salty meats.
- Apricot Preserves: Offering a delicate balance of sweet and slightly tart, apricot preserves provide a sunny, fruity note that lightens the richness of the cheese and bacon.
When selecting your preserves, consider the overall balance. A preserve with some natural tartness will prevent the bites from becoming overly rich or sweet. Don’t be afraid to try different combinations to find your perfect sweet-and-savory match!

Bacon Raspberry Cheese Bites FAQ’s
Absolutely! These cheese bites are incredibly convenient for make-ahead preparations, which is perfect when you’re hosting. You can assemble them completely, then neatly arrange them on a baking sheet and wrap them tightly with plastic wrap. Store them in the refrigerator for up to two days before you plan to bake and serve. This allows you to tackle most of the prep work in advance, minimizing stress on the day of your event and ensuring you can enjoy your guests.
Knowing when your bacon cheese bites are perfectly done is simple. Keep an eye on them in the oven; they’re ready when the phyllo cups have achieved a beautiful light golden-brown color, indicating their crispness. More importantly, the cheese should be fully melted and visibly bubbly, often with a slight golden edge. This usually takes between 5 to 7 minutes in a preheated oven, but ovens vary, so always trust your visual cues. The melted cheese and slightly toasted phyllo are indicators of their readiness.
You’ll want to use pre-baked, frozen phyllo pastry shells, which are typically found in the freezer aisle near other pastry doughs. These are incredibly convenient as they are already shaped and baked to a delicate crispness. They are thin enough that they don’t require thawing before filling and baking, saving you precious prep time.
While the traditional phyllo cups contain gluten, some specialty grocery stores or health food markets may offer gluten-free phyllo dough or pre-made gluten-free mini pastry shells. If you can find suitable gluten-free cups, the rest of the recipe (cheese, preserves, bacon) is naturally gluten-free, making it easy to adapt for those with dietary restrictions.

Easy Bacon Raspberry Cheese Bites
Equipment
-
WÜSTHOF Gourmet 7″ Hollow Edge Santoku Knife
-
Magnetic Measuring Spoons Set of 8 Stainless Steel Dual Sided
-
USA Pan Global Nonstick Aluminum Half Sheet Pan, Set of 2
Ingredients
- 1.9 ounce package phyllo cups
- 8 ounces brie or camembert cheese
- ⅓ cup raspberry preserves
- 4 slices cooked bacon, finely chopped
Instructions
-
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F.
-
Remove the cups from the package and arrange them on a small baking sheet.
-
Remove the rind of the cheese and divide into 15 even pieces and place one in each of the cups.
-
Add 1 teaspoon of raspberry preserves to each of the cups.
-
Top each cup with crumbled bacon and bake for 5 to 7 minutes until the cheese has melted.
-
Enjoy warm or at room temperature.
Notes
- Phyllo cups are found in the freezer section near the phyllo dough. You can bake from frozen, they are very thin so no need to thaw before using.
- Brie is a more crowd-pleasing cheese option since camembert can have a fairly rustic and acquired flavor.
